Output f4db2139c8017dcaaa17f1ade93aadd51f5b2c249565b4a5be9ee74fcdfe2094:0

value
76203020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55988ea314a6f9a8c143b6e894352f76cc04b55c OP_EQUAL
address
39Vc7i18AdXVmQCh771RBKnPmXqwio6i73
transaction
f4db2139c8017dcaaa17f1ade93aadd51f5b2c249565b4a5be9ee74fcdfe2094
confirmations
371804
spent
true